Assume the November transactions for Camindo Co. are as follows:
Received cash of $60,000 from investors in exchange for common stock.
Provided services of $16,300 on account.
Purchased supplies on account $750.
Received cash of $11,800 from clients for services previously billed.
Received $6,250 for services provided from clients who paid cash.
Paid $600 on account for supplies that had been purchased.
Paid $3,380 for a one-year insurance policy.
Paid the following expenses: wages, $7,800; utilities, $1,000; rent, $3,750.
Paid dividends of $2,300 to stockholders.
Required:
Record the transactions, using the integrated financial statement.

Suppose that two firms produce differentiated products and compete in prices. as in class, the two firms are located at two ends of a line one mile apart. consumers are evenly distributed along the line. the firms have identical marginal cost, $60. firm b produces a product with value $110 to consumers.firm a (located at 0 on the unit line) produces a higher quality product with value $120 to consumers. the cost of travel are directly related to the distance a consumer travels to purchase a good. if a consumerhas to travel a mile to purchase a good, the incur a cost of $20. if they have to travel x fraction of a mile, they incur a cost of $20x. (a) write down the expressions for how much a consumer at location d would value the products sold by firms a and b, if they set prices p_{a} and p_{b} ? (b) based on your expressions in (a), how much will be demanded from each firm if prices p_{a} and p_{b} are set? (c) what are the nash equilibrium prices?
